Mobile-First Design Tips for Roofing Websites

People looking for roofing services aren’t just on desktops anymore—they’re scrolling through websites on their phones while standing in their driveway or sitting in traffic. If your roofing website isn’t built with mobile users in mind, you’re missing out on the kind of traffic that actually converts. A mobile-first design makes sure your potential customers have the best experience, no matter which device they’re using.
Mobile habits have completely changed how homeowners search for roofing services. They want results fast, information that’s easy to understand, and a way to contact you without any struggle. The idea here isn’t just to look good on a mobile screen. It’s about building trust and making it simple for someone to take action. This article breaks down the key parts of mobile-first design so your roofing website does its job right where most searches are now happening—on phones.
Why Mobile-First Design Matters for Roofers
More than ever, people are using phones to search for roofing help. Whether it’s a leaking roof after a big storm or planning ahead for a home upgrade, most of that searching happens between errands or from their couch. So if your site doesn’t load fast or work smoothly on a phone, they’ll move on to one that does.
A good mobile-first design isn’t just a nice feature. It actually makes the entire experience better for the person visiting your site. Think about it. No one wants to pinch and zoom to find a phone number or fight through pop-ups to read what you can do for them. The easier your website is to navigate and understand, the more likely a visitor turns into a lead.
Here’s what a mobile-optimized design can help you with:
– Quicker load times, which keeps people from bouncing right off the site
– Faster access to key info like services, reviews, and contact buttons
– More completed contact forms and calls because everything feels simple
A roofing website that’s built for mobile lets your message sink in more clearly. When people can easily scroll, read, and reach out, they’re more likely to trust you with their next roofing project.
Key Elements of Mobile-First Design
There’s a big difference between a website that adjusts to mobile and one that’s been built with mobile in mind from the start. Let’s break down the parts that matter the most when you’re trying to build a user-friendly mobile site.
Simplified Navigation
Nobody has the patience to dig through messy menus. A clean and simple layout works best for mobile users. Your navigation menu should be easy to find—usually at the top in the form of a hamburger icon—and offer just the must-know links.
Try trimming down the options to a few key sections like:
– Services
– About
– Reviews
– Contact
If there’s too much going on, it only confuses visitors. Keep it tight and organized.
Fast Load Times
Speed matters more than people think. If your roofing website takes too long to load, people assume service might be the same way—slow and frustrating. That’s not a great first impression.
To make your website load faster:
– Compress image files without making them look fuzzy
– Cut out extra scripts or plug-ins that aren’t needed
– Use caching tools that keep parts of your site ready to go
You want the whole page to load within seconds or you’re at risk of losing the visitor before they even see what you offer.
Readable Text and Buttons
Mobile screens are small, so oversized text blocks or tiny fonts just don’t work. Your content should be short, easy to read, and spaced properly. Stick with strong headlines and clear subheadings to break things up.
Also, make sure your buttons are large enough to tap without stretching fingers. That includes:
– Click-to-call buttons
– Get A Quote or Contact Us buttons
– Service area links
Don’t make someone zoom in just to click. That’s a fast way to lose their interest.
Responsive Design
Responsive design just means your website adjusts automatically to any device size. Whether it’s viewed on a phone, tablet, or desktop, everything needs to stay sharp, centered, and functional.
You can test your site using tools like Google’s Mobile-Friendly Test to spot where things break or don’t look right. Pay close attention to spacing, image scaling, and whether forms are still usable when scrunched into a smaller screen.
Taking time to check how your website behaves across different screen sizes helps you catch issues before your visitors do. Fixing those issues is one of the easiest ways to boost the experience for every visitor.
Incorporating User-Friendly Features
Once your roofing website has the core layout and design in place for mobile users, it’s time to go a step further with features that make it even easier for visitors to take action. These small additions can make a big difference in generating leads and providing a smoother experience.
Click-to-Call Buttons
These are a must. Mobile users don’t want to dig around for your phone number. With a click-to-call button, all they have to do is tap once and they’re dialing you. It takes the effort out of reaching out, which means more calls to your business.
Place these buttons in obvious spots like your homepage, contact page, and even on service pages with clear Call Now labels. Make sure they stand out from the rest of the content. If a homeowner just found hail damage and is scrolling frantically on their phone, they’ll appreciate the instant access to help.
Location-Based Services
If your roofing services are tied to a specific area, GPS features can improve how customers interact with your site. With location tools enabled, your website can show driving directions or estimated service areas right from a map.
For example, if someone’s searching while parked outside their house, a linked map with a pin drop and route can encourage them to call right away. It’s one less step for them to figure out if you serve their location.
Mobile-Friendly Forms
You don’t need long forms on a phone. In fact, the longer the form, the more likely someone will leave before finishing. Keep your mobile forms short and simple—just ask for their name, a way to reach them, and maybe a short message.
Use dropdowns and checkboxes wherever possible so users don’t have to type everything out. Bigger form fields and auto-fill options also help cut down on typing errors or phone frustrations.
Here’s a quick checklist to improve your lead forms for mobile:
– Use 3–5 fields max
– Pick dropdown menus over free-text boxes
– Use large input fields with visible text
– Limit required fields to the absolute basics
– Showcase a short confirmation message when the form is submitted
User-friendly features like these aren’t just nice to have. They play a real part in moving a visitor to take the next step.
Testing And Monitoring Your Mobile Site
Don’t assume your roofing website runs perfectly just because it looks good on one phone. Different devices can load content in different ways. You could be missing out on leads if your pages break or fail to load correctly on certain screens.
Regular testing helps stay ahead of tech hiccups and other issues that may come up. Use common tools like Google’s Mobile-Friendly Test to catch layout problems or slow-loading images. A good idea is to test at least once a month, especially if you’re adding new content or updating features.
Try pulling your site up on multiple devices—a few Android phones, an iPhone, and even a tablet. Walk through it like a customer would. How long does it take before you can call or fill out a form? Are all the menus easy to tap? Do the images show up clean and centered?
When it’s time to refresh the site, avoid guessing. Monitor your visitor behavior using tools like heat maps or basic site analytics. Glassbox or Hotjar-type software (if you’re using them) can even show you real recordings of how users interact with your website.
Make updates based on what visitors are actually doing, not what you assume they want. That’s the fastest way to make meaningful improvements without creating extra work for yourself.
Your Roofing Website Should Work Where It Matters Most
A mobile-first website isn’t just about shrinking everything to fit a phone screen. It’s about designing the experience based on how people actually use their phones. From fast load times to simple forms and clickable buttons, each piece comes together to guide someone from search to action with as little friction as possible.
Getting these design pieces right can lead to better engagement, more calls, and more qualified leads. It shows customers that you value their time and understand what they’re looking for—quick answers, easy contact, and a clear path forward.
If your roofing business hasn’t looked at its website from a phone screen lately, now’s the time. People searching on mobile aren’t just browsing. They’re ready to make a decision. The easier it is for them to reach out, the quicker you see real results from your online presence.
Wrapping up your mobile-first website can significantly influence your business’s success in the roofing industry. It’s all about making sure your site is designed to meet customers where they are, mainly on their phones. By focusing on user-friendly features, fast load times, and intuitive navigation, you don’t just enhance the user experience; you boost the chances of converting visitors into customers. If you’re ready to improve your site and capitalize on more opportunities, learn more about web design for roofers and how Roofing Lead Magnet can help you create a site that truly connects with your audience.